The Impact of Mental Health Assessment: Understanding Its Importance and Implications
Mental health assessments play an essential function in determining, diagnosing, and providing efficient treatment for individuals dealing with mental health challenges. The process typically includes a combination of interviews, questionnaires, and clinical assessments that assist mental health specialists gather informative information about an individual's psychological state. This post explores the impact of mental health assessments, highlighting their significance, methodologies, benefits, and challenges.
Understanding Mental Health Assessment
A mental health assessment is an organized method used by mental health professionals to evaluate an individual's emotional, psychological, and social wellness. The primary objectives of these assessments are to:

The mental health assessment process typically involves several essential components:
Clinical Interview: A structured or semi-structured dialogue in between the clinician and the individual to check out symptoms, history, and personal background.Psychological Testing: Objective tests, such as questionnaires or standardized assessments, to assess specific areas of mental health.Observation: Clinicians thoroughly observe the individual's behavior, psychological responses, and interactions.Collaboration: Involving household members or better halves can provide additional insights into the individual's habits and mindset.
The assessment process is comprehensive and tailored to the individual's unique requirements, ensuring that experts collect appropriate info for accurate diagnoses and effective interventions.

Early Diagnosis: One of the most considerable benefits of mental health assessments is the capability to determine concerns early. Early diagnosis can lead to prompt intervention, boosting healing rates and decreasing long-lasting problems.
Educated Treatment Plans: Accurate assessments offer experts with a clear photo of the person's mental health, allowing them to craft personalized treatment strategies. Reliable treatment can consist of therapy, medication, or a mix of both, tailored to the individual's specific requirements.

Research and Policy Development: Aggregate data from assessments play a critical function in mental health research and the formulation of policies. It assists in recognizing patterns, informing public health strategies, and advocating for enhanced mental health resources.
Long-Term Monitoring: Mental health assessments are not a one-time process. They are crucial for tracking development gradually, assisting in required modifications in treatment strategies, and ensuring ongoing support.
Potential Challenges in Mental Health Assessments
While mental health assessments carry many benefits, they are not without obstacles. Some of these include:
Subjectivity: Responses during interviews and questionnaires can be subjective, influenced by different aspects consisting of the individual's mood, understanding, and desire to share.
Resource Limitations: Availability of skilled specialists and mental health resources can pose barriers, particularly in underserved neighborhoods.
Cultural Sensitivity: Mental health assessments must consider cultural distinctions and beliefs. Misinterpreting cultural contexts can lead to inaccurate assessments.
The Role of Technology in Mental Health Assessments
The increase of telehealth and digital tools has actually had an extensive influence on mental health assessments. Technology boosts ease of access and effectiveness through:

Mental health assessments are conducted by various experts, including psychologists, psychiatrists, licensed therapists, and social workers. Each expert may utilize different assessment methods based on their training and competence.
How typically should mental health assessments be carried out?
The frequency of mental health assessments mainly depends upon private needs. Usually, people going through treatment might be assessed frequently to keep an eye on development, while those with no prior issues may gain from occasional examinations, particularly throughout substantial life occasions.
Are mental health assessments covered by insurance?
Coverage for mental health assessments differs by insurance coverage supplier and policy. It is suggested for individuals to talk to their insurance provider relating to coverage information and to interact with their doctor about expenses.
Can mental health assessments identify all mental health conditions?
While mental health assessments are designed to collect comprehensive information, they may not always recognize every condition. Complex or co-occurring disorders might need more substantial evaluation and observation.
